Pau gasol was good but there was something missing when he was here. Something Carlos boozer had. Not sure what it is. I missed boozer even though he sucked at defense.
The oddly interesting thing is with Boozer the Bulls were load better at defense.

With Gasol, their D-rating dropped out of the Top 10.

2010-11: 11th Offense, 2nd Defense
2011-12: 5th Offense, 2nd Defense
2012-13: 23rd Offense, 6th Defense
2013-14: 28th Offense, 2nd Defense
----- (Boozer amnestied) ------
2014-15: 11th Offense, 11th Defense
2015-16: 23rd Offense, 15th Defense (Thibs fired, Hoiberg hired)

Now, certainly not the only factor in the Bulls defensive collapse. They seemed to go for more offense in general in 2014-15 with picking up Gasol, McDermott, Niko, and Aaron Brooks.. all guys not known for playing defense.
